在Linux系统中,配置命令路径通常涉及到环境变量的设置,尤其是PATH
变量。PATH
变量定义了系统在执行命令时搜索可执行文件的目录列表。
基础概念:
优势:
类型:
/etc/profile
或/etc/environment
文件中设置。~/.bashrc
、~/.bash_profile
或~/.profile
文件中设置。应用场景:
PATH
变量中,以便用户可以方便地执行。配置方法:
/new/directory
添加到当前PATH
变量的末尾。/etc/profile
或/etc/environment
文件,添加如下行:/etc/profile
或/etc/environment
文件,添加如下行:~/.bashrc
、~/.bash_profile
或~/.profile
文件,添加相同的行。常见问题及解决方法:
PATH
变量指定的目录中。解决方法是将该命令所在的目录添加到PATH
变量中。PATH
变量中先出现的那个目录下的文件。可以通过调整PATH
变量中的目录顺序来解决冲突。示例代码:
假设你想将自定义的脚本目录/home/user/scripts
添加到PATH
变量中,可以在~/.bashrc
文件中添加以下行:
export PATH=$PATH:/home/user/scripts
然后运行以下命令使更改生效:
source ~/.bashrc
之后,你就可以在任何位置直接运行该目录下的脚本,而无需指定完整路径。
领取专属 10元无门槛券
手把手带您无忧上云